EPA to hold webinar on its new pollinator plan

EPA is hosting a public webinar that will provide background information and additional details about its proposed plan to prohibit the use of all highly toxic pesticides when crops are in bloom and bees are present under contract for pollination services. 

The plan also recommends that states and tribes develop pollinator protections plans and best management practices. EPA has already held webinars with states and tribes. 

The public webinar will be on June 23 from 3 - 4:30p.m. Eastern and accessible
